    Alyssa Bustamante killed a 9 year old neighbor girl when she was 15 years old and then came home and wrote this in her journal:

    ""I just f------ killed someone. I strangled them and slit their throat and stabbed them now they're dead. I don't know how to feel atm. It was ahmazing. As soon as you get over the "ohmygawd I can't do this" feeling, it's pretty enjoyable. I'm kinda nervous and shaky though right now. Kay, I gotta go to church now...lol."

    msnbc

    What do you think? Do ya'll blame her mother (popular to do) or not? She is 18 now, going to trial. What do you think would be an appropriate punishment for her?
